The Complaint repossession document for car in Florida is a legal form utilized to initiate a replevin action, enabling a party to regain possession of a vehicle unlawfully held by another. This document outlines the parties involved, jurisdiction, and factual basis for the complaint, including details about loans, contracts, and the vehicles in question. Essential features include the claimer's rights, the declaration of default, and the necessary legal justifications for replevin. To utilize this form effectively, users should clearly fill in party names, case details, and specify relevant contracts, along with including necessary exhibits as supporting documentation. The form is designed for a variety of legal professionals, including attorneys, paralegals, and legal assistants, who support clients in recovering possession of their vehicles. Specific use cases involve situations where a borrower defaults on payment agreements, allowing lenders to reclaim property. Users should ensure compliance with state laws and local court requirements when filing. This document also includes provisions for seeking expedited hearings and recovery of legal costs associated with the action.
